Question: Art & Home Decorating and Restrcucture?
I am looking to research the best way to upgrade my 1950's flat-top home without loosing too much of it's orginal look, but expanding some room areas. I have gone though the DIY website and This Old House? The plans came back from the Artchitect, but I really am looking for some epansion, deocarting ideas for smaller rooms, and style ohter than "Botter Barn & IKEA look? What I want is my original style, but I need some inspiration because I'd like to keep the 1950's look with a twist of a modern yet Artistic style. Any website suggestions, books, magazines?
I already have BH& G, House So Beautiful, and so forth. I want ideas that are hard to find because of their originality. Thank You!
Answer: I would start by looking through old 1950's magazines. Such as House Beautiful - Better Homes & Gardens, you would not believe how much inspiration you can get, plus, there are design plans and decorating ideas. I have a bunch of the magazines from the 40's & 50's. I look at them all the time. You can buy them pretty reasonable from ebay. Just search under magazines, back issues.
